Tragic Outcome: Woman Who Declined Ride from Intoxicated Coworker Fatally Struck Later by Them in the Evening

According to authorities, a young woman from New York, aged 22, made the decision to decline her drunk coworker's offer for a ride in his car after a night out. Instead, she chose to walk.

Tragically, later that same night, the coworker struck and fatally injured her in a hit-and-run incident.

From USA Today


Madison Faltisco went out with coworker Joshua Schiano, 23, Thursday night and the two went to a few bars in the Syracuse area, according to Thomas Newton, public information officer for the Onondaga County Sheriff’s Office.

Interviews with people who knew Faltisco and the investigation showed that after a few hours, Faltisco chose not to get into Schiano's car with him because she knew he was intoxicated, Newton told USA TODAY. She decided to make what would have been a long walk home, about 3 or 4 miles, Newton said.

She didn't get very far. Less than a quarter-mile down the road, while Faltisco was walking along the shoulder, Schiano hit her with his Hyundai Elantra, according to a criminal complaint provided by the Onondaga County District Attorney's Office.

"That's when Joshua in his vehicle went onto the shoulder of the road struck her, and he continued off," Newton said.

Shortly after, Schiano crashed into a pole about a mile away and his car burst into flames, Newton said. He was taken to a hospital.

It wasn't until more than six hours later that Faltisco's body was found on the side of the road in the early morning.
